Maleate trihydrate sodium is an organic compound classified as a type of salt. It results from the neutralization reaction between maleic acid and sodium hydroxide and has a slightly bitter taste. In industrial settings, it serves numerous functions, particularly as an intermediate in synthesizing various chemicals and polymers. Additionally, it is utilized in the food and beverage industry as a buffering agent, flavor enhancer, and preservative.
